McMaster Children’s Hospital (MCH), located on the McMaster University campus in Hamilton’s beautiful Westdale neighbourhood, has been providing care to children from across the region since 1988. Here, patients ranging in age from infancy to 18 years and benefit from a family-centred approach that prioritizes the child’s emotional, mental, and physical well-being. 
The hospital is home to the fastest-growing kids-only emergency department in Ontario, one of Canada’s most advanced neonatal intensive care units, and a range of programs and clinics with unique expertise in a number of areas including children’s cancer, digestive diseases, and mental health.

The Pediatric Intensive Care Unit (PICU) at McMaster Children’s Hospital is a robust department, comprised of 12 level 3 critical care beds, and 4 level 2 step down beds, a Pediatric Critical Care Response team and a newly formed Pediatric Critical Care Transport Team, all which provide medical and surgical care to children and their families across southern Ontario. The interdisciplinary team provides family centered care with a strong focus on evidence based best practice and continuous improvement initiatives. The unit provides specialized care to complex, surgical, oncologic, orthopedic, trauma and medical pediatric patient populations utilizing a collaborative approach. The PICU team engages in advanced therapies including continuous renal replacement therapy, therapeutic plasma exchange, and organ donation.
